Founded in 1998, the family owned company is situated in Rimpar, Lower Franconia. The small but excellent manufactory for hand-made single items has ever since been committed to serve and support MR scientists in their individual projects and applications while valuing fair and honest relationships to customers, partners and employees as a precious asset. This approach, as a company philosophy, is a solid building block of our ongoing success in a complex market – and is being continued by Felix Faskerty who is today the sole private owner of RAPID Biomedical as well as of the FASTRON Group. RAPID Biomedical so far has delivered more than 1200 different coil designs into more than 30 countries all over the world. We have thorough experience in designing and manufacturing coils from low field to UHF human and animal scanners up to 21 T NMR systems. The range of non-proton solutions delivered by RAPID Biomedical includes 11 different nuclei (and counting). RAPID Biomedical is partner and supplier to various established Original Equipment Manufacturers (OEMs) for their exclusive distribution of high quality MR equipment. Up to date, all coils are manufactured in Rimpar, Germany.

Teliatry was founded by members of two pioneers in biomedical device R&D: the Texas Biomedical Device Center (TXBDC) and Zyvex Labs. Rahul co-founded Teliatry in 2018 with a vision to disrupt the Active implantable medical device manufacturing. Teliatry is a fast-growing startup aimed at disrupting the medical device market. Teliatry is an ISO 13485:2016 and ISO 9001:2015 certified company that designs, develops and manufactures next generation Class II devices and minimally invasive and miniature Class III implantable medical device systems for the neuromodulation, deep brain stimulation, neurostimulation, sensing, and active implantable medical device (AIMD) systems global market. We have developed a platform technology which we provide as a contract biomedical device manufacturer for biomedical device companies that need minimally invasive, injectable, or highly miniaturized implant systems. Our initial device is a wireless neurostimulator system developed for vagus nerve stimulation. We have a well-established supply chain for our manufacturing approach that is wafer scale, automated and highly scalable to large volumes, dramatically lowering the cost, while improving the capabilities and reliability over existing manufacturing approaches. „Optogenetics“

Optogenetics is a technique in neuroscience which uses light to control cells in living tissue, typically neurons, that have been genetically modified to express light-sensitive ion channels. By doing this, it is possible to measure and control the activity of these cells with remarkable precision. This can be used to study the function of neural circuits in the brain, as well as to develop new treatments for neurological disorders.
